Top definition
Mental. Fucked in the head. Disturbed. Cool in a fucked up way. Has also gained currency as simply: foolish.

Orig. Rhyming Slang (UK), not necessarily only used by davids.
Back in the day when consumer electronics were very expensive, often needed maintainance/repair and we were poor, Radio Rental was a large British company which rented... TV sets. (Doh!)

Often shortened to just Radio.
Dude, put your cock away, we're on the fucking bus! Are you fucking radio, or what?

Vice City? Radio Rental mate.

Wow! Totally, like RRRRRRRRaaaaaaaaaaadioooooo RRRRRReeeental!

Shut it radio.
by edjog! December 21, 2005
Get the mug
Get a Radio Rental mug for your daughter Yasemin.